Understanding Pressure Washer Nozzle Colors
Choosing the right attachment is crucial for achieving optimal results. Each attachment is designed for specific tasks, and knowing their characteristics ensures effective cleaning without damaging surfaces.
Here’s a breakdown of common attachments:
- Red (0 degrees): Produces a concentrated beam of water, ideal for removing tough stains but can damage delicate surfaces.
- Yellow (15 degrees): Provides a narrow spray pattern, suitable for heavy-duty cleaning tasks like stripping paint or removing stubborn grime.
- Green (25 degrees): Offers a wider spray pattern, effective for general cleaning on various surfaces, including driveways and patios.
- White (40 degrees): Delivers a gentle spray, perfect for delicate surfaces such as vehicles and outdoor furniture.
- Black (soap nozzle): Specifically designed for applying soap, ensuring even coverage during the cleaning process.
When using the right attachment, consider the surface condition and the type of grime present. For instance, the green attachment is often preferred for regular maintenance, while the yellow attachment is selected for tougher jobs.
Always test a small, inconspicuous area first to ensure compatibility with the surface being cleaned. This practice helps prevent unintentional damage and guarantees satisfaction with the cleaning outcome.
Identifying the Right Nozzle for Concrete Surfaces
Utilizing a 25-degree nozzle is the most effective choice for tackling hard surfaces like driveways and patios. This setting strikes a balance between power and coverage, ensuring thorough cleaning without risking damage. For tougher stains, a 15-degree nozzle is ideal, providing a concentrated stream to penetrate deeply embedded grime.
When using the 25-degree option, maintain a distance of about 12 inches from the surface. This distance prevents potential etching while allowing effective dirt removal. If more stubborn marks persist, I switch to the 15-degree setting, adjusting my distance to about 6-8 inches for optimal pressure without harming the material.
Additionally, I recommend testing the chosen nozzle on a small, inconspicuous area first. This step helps assess how the surface reacts, ensuring there are no adverse effects before proceeding with the entire area.
Staying aware of the pressure settings on your equipment is also essential. Lower pressures can be effective for routine cleanings, while higher settings are reserved for more challenging jobs. By adjusting both the nozzle type and pressure, I achieve the best results without risking damage to the surface.

Factors Influencing Nozzle Selection for Concrete
The type of surface, level of grime, and specific cleaning goals significantly impact the choice of nozzle. For rough or textured surfaces, a narrower spray pattern is necessary to reach into crevices effectively. Conversely, smooth surfaces may benefit from a wider spray to cover more area without causing damage.
The amount of built-up dirt or stains also plays a role. Heavier residue requires a more concentrated spray, while lighter cleaning tasks can utilize a broader angle. Environmental factors, such as wind or nearby vegetation, should be considered to prevent overspray and potential damage to surrounding areas.
Pressure settings of the machine are crucial. High-pressure units can cause harm if paired with the wrong attachment. Testing on a small, inconspicuous section of the surface can help determine the appropriate setting and attachment before proceeding with the entire area.
Material type is another key element. While concrete is generally durable, different blends or finishes may react differently to high pressure. Always assess the specific characteristics of the concrete before selecting a nozzle.
Lastly, the operator’s experience and comfort with the equipment can influence nozzle choice. Familiarity with nozzle angles and their effects allows for more confident and effective cleaning.
Common Mistakes When Choosing Pressure Washer Tips
One prevalent error is selecting a nozzle without considering the specific surface or material being cleaned. Each type of surface requires a different approach, and using an inappropriate attachment can lead to damage or ineffective cleaning.
Another mistake involves ignoring the manufacturer’s recommendations. Not adhering to the guidelines can result in suboptimal performance and potential harm to the equipment.
Many users fail to assess the level of grime or stains present. This oversight can lead to underestimating the power needed for thorough cleaning. A more powerful nozzle may be necessary for stubborn stains.
Some individuals neglect to test the spray pattern on a small, inconspicuous area before proceeding. This precaution helps avoid unintentional damage and allows for adjustments based on the response of the surface.
Additionally, individuals often underestimate the importance of adjusting the distance from the surface. Standing too close or too far can affect the cleaning effectiveness and may require multiple passes, wasting time and resources.
Lastly, not maintaining the nozzles properly can lead to clogs or damage. Regular inspection and cleaning are essential to ensure optimal functionality and longevity of the attachments.
